资源介绍
PHP&MYSQL操作函数
主要内容:
理解数据库操作流程;
掌握基本SQL语句;
掌握数据库基本操作;
学会使用PHPMyAdmin工具;
第一节 连接数据
(1)连接服务器 格式:
mysql_connect ( [string server [, string username [, string password [, bool new_link
[, int client_flags]]]]])
(2)选择数据库 格式:
bool mysql_select_db ( string database_name [, resource link_identifier])
第二节 创建查询
mysql_query()函数来执行SQL语句
$conn=mysql_connect('localhost','root','123456')
or die("数据库打开失败!");
if (mysql_select_db("user",$conn))
{
Mysql_query(“set names ‘gbk’”);//设置编码
echo "我们选择了user数据库!"; }
else
{ echo "我们没有打开user数据库"; }
$rs=mysql_query("select * from admin",$conn)
or die("查询表admin失败");
?>
$rs 返回值,用于显示select的结果
第三节 显示记录集
1.mysql_fetch_array()将记录集以数组的形式保存起来。
//数据库打开代码 略
$query=mysql_query(“select * from news”);
$rows=mysql_num_rows($query); //取得记录数量
echo "
$array[id] $array[user] $array[pwd]
";
?>
2.mysql_fetch_row()将记录集以数组的形式保存起来。以0开始偏移。
//数据库打开代码 略
$query=mysql_query(“select * from news”);
$rows=mysql_num_rows($query); //取得记录数量
echo " $row[0] $row[1] $row[2]
";
?>
3.mysql_fetch_object()将所记录集以对象的形式保存起来 .
//在此不做介绍
最后,我们需要释放查询资源并关闭数据库连接。
//数据库打开代码 略
mysql_free_result( $rs );
mysql_close( $conn ); // 实际上数据库的连接会在脚本执行完后被PHP自动关闭 ?>
PHP和数据库之间的操作其实非常简单:
1.连接并打开数据库:mysql_connect()、mysql_select_db()
2.执行SQL语句:mysql_query()
3.取回记录集:mysql_fetch_array()、mysql_fetch_rows()、mysql_fetch_object()
4.显示记录集
5.释放资源:mysql_free_result()